The Hisense QD6 represents the mature, refined approach to 4K TV technology. QLED stands for "Quantum Dot Light Emitting Diode"—essentially, it places a layer of microscopic semiconductor particles between the LED backlight and the LCD panel. These quantum dots act like precision color filters, converting the blue light from LEDs into highly pure red and green light.
The result? Colors that cover about 90% of the DCI-P3 color space that modern movies and streaming content use, compared to roughly 70% for standard LED TVs. This isn't marketing fluff—the difference is immediately visible when watching vibrant content like nature documentaries or animated films.
The QD6 uses full-array local dimming, which means LEDs are arranged behind the entire screen (rather than just around the edges) and grouped into zones that can brighten or dim independently. Think of it like having several dozen light switches controlling different sections of your ceiling—you can make the kitchen bright while keeping the living room dim.
The QD7 takes a fundamentally different approach with Mini-LED technology. Instead of using regular-sized LEDs grouped into zones, it employs thousands of tiny LEDs—each about the size of a grain of sand—arranged behind the screen with much more precise control.
Here's why this matters: traditional local dimming might have 50-100 zones across a 65" screen, but Mini-LED systems can have 500+ zones. When you're watching a scene with both a bright explosion and a dark night sky, the QD7 can make the explosion brilliant while keeping the sky truly black, all within the same frame.
The trade-off is complexity. More zones mean more processing power, more potential for software glitches, and generally higher costs. But when it works well, Mini-LED delivers contrast performance that approaches OLED TVs at a fraction of the price.
Both TVs achieve similar peak brightness levels—around 600-700 nits in typical viewing conditions. To put that in perspective, a bright sunny day measures about 100,000 nits, while a typical indoor room ranges from 100-500 nits. So these TVs can definitely get bright enough to compete with ambient light in most living rooms.
The difference lies in how they handle High Dynamic Range (HDR) content. HDR essentially means the TV can display a wider range from deep blacks to bright whites, creating more realistic images. Both the QD6 and QD7 support all major HDR formats: HDR10, HDR10+, Dolby Vision, and HLG (Hybrid Log-Gamma for broadcast TV).
But supporting HDR formats and delivering impressive HDR performance are different things. The QD6 handles HDR competently with solid contrast and color, though it won't make you gasp like premium TVs do. The QD7 leverages its Mini-LED precision to create more dramatic highlights and shadows within the same scene, though some professional reviews noted that its black levels aren't quite as deep as expected from Mini-LED technology.
This is where both TVs truly shine for their price range. The quantum dot technology in both models delivers colors that look natural rather than artificially saturated. Skin tones appear realistic, grass looks genuinely green rather than neon, and sunset scenes maintain their warmth without becoming orange disasters.
The QD7 has a slight edge in maintaining color accuracy across different brightness levels within the same image, thanks to its more precise backlight control. But honestly, both TVs deliver color performance that matches TVs costing significantly more just two years ago.
Here's a practical consideration that spec sheets often ignore: how does the picture look when you're not sitting directly in front? Both TVs use LCD panels, which inherently have narrower viewing angles than OLED displays.
However, our research indicates the QD7 maintains color and brightness better when viewed from the side—important if you have a wide seating arrangement or kitchen island where people might watch at an angle. The QD6 is perfectly fine for typical couch viewing but shows more color shifting when viewed off-center.
This category reveals the most significant difference between these TVs, and it's not subtle.
The QD7 operates at 144Hz—meaning it can display 144 unique images per second. For comparison, movies run at 24 frames per second, and most TV content runs at 30 or 60 fps. This high refresh rate becomes crucial for gaming, where more frames per second create smoother motion and more responsive controls.
The QD6 operates at 60Hz with motion interpolation to simulate higher refresh rates. Motion interpolation essentially creates artificial frames between the real ones, which can make movies look smoother but introduces latency that serious gamers will notice immediately.
Both TVs support Variable Refresh Rate (VRR) and Auto Low Latency Mode (ALLM)—features that help eliminate screen tearing and reduce input lag when gaming. But the QD7 takes this further with support for AMD FreeSync Premium and HDMI 2.1 bandwidth.
HDMI 2.1 is the latest connection standard that supports higher resolutions and refresh rates. If you own a PlayStation 5, Xbox Series X, or a modern gaming PC, the QD7 can actually utilize their full capabilities. The QD6 will work with these devices but can't take advantage of their highest performance modes.
Based on user reviews and technical testing, the QD7 delivers a genuinely different gaming experience. Fast-paced games like racing titles or first-person shooters feel more responsive and look cleaner during rapid movement. The QD6 works fine for casual gaming but shows its limitations with competitive gaming or graphically demanding titles.
One reviewer specifically mentioned that their older Xbox One performed noticeably better with the QD7's 144Hz capability, proving these features benefit even older consoles through better motion handling.
Both TVs run Amazon's Fire TV platform with Alexa built-in, providing access to all major streaming services plus voice control for both the TV and compatible smart home devices. Fire TV has matured significantly over the past few years, offering a more responsive and intuitive interface than many competitors.
However, our research revealed some interesting differences in platform stability. QD6 users consistently report smooth, reliable operation with minimal glitches. QD7 users generally praise the interface responsiveness but mention occasional quirks like incorrect app icons in search results or intermittent freezes requiring restarts.
This suggests that the QD7's more advanced processing might introduce some software complexity. Nothing deal-breaking, but worth considering if you prioritize rock-solid stability over cutting-edge features.
If you're setting up a dedicated home theater or media room, the choice between these TVs depends heavily on your lighting control and seating arrangement.
The QD6 excels in dark room scenarios where its superior native contrast becomes apparent. When local dimming isn't actively working—like during scenes with consistent brightness across the frame—the QD6 produces deeper blacks and more natural shadow detail. Its RGB subpixel layout also makes it excellent for occasional PC use, displaying text clearly without the color fringing that some TV panels create.
The QD7 works better in mixed lighting conditions where ambient light might wash out darker scenes. Its Mini-LED precision maintains image quality across a wider range of lighting conditions, though some home theater enthusiasts might prefer the QD6's more natural contrast in dedicated dark rooms.
For audio, both TVs include identical 20W Dolby Atmos systems that provide adequate sound for casual viewing. However, virtually every user review mentions significant improvement when adding even a modest soundbar—something worth budgeting for regardless of which TV you choose.

The key difference is display technology: the Hisense QD6 uses traditional QLED with full-array local dimming, while the Hisense QD7 features advanced Mini-LED backlighting with thousands of precision dimming zones. The QD7 also offers 144Hz gaming compared to the QD6's 60Hz refresh rate.
The Hisense QD7 is significantly better for gaming with its 144Hz refresh rate, HDMI 2.1 support, VRR, ALLM, and AMD FreeSync Premium. The QD6 only offers 60Hz gaming with basic VRR/ALLM support, making it suitable for casual gaming but not competitive or next-gen console gaming.
For dedicated dark-room home theaters, the Hisense QD6 often performs better due to its superior native contrast ratios. However, if your theater has any ambient lighting, the QD7's Mini-LED technology maintains better image quality across mixed lighting conditions.
The Hisense QD7 performs better in bright rooms due to its Mini-LED backlighting providing better ambient light handling and maintaining contrast in challenging lighting conditions. The QD6 works adequately but may struggle with glare in very bright environments.
The Hisense QD7 maintains better color and brightness when viewed from the side, making it more suitable for wide seating arrangements. The QD6 shows more typical LCD viewing angle limitations with color shifting when viewed off-center.
